What are some human errors in an experiment?
If you know that you have made such a mistake – a “human” error – you simply cannot use the results.
- spilling, or sloppiness, dropping the equiment, etc.
- bad calculations, doing math incorrectly, or using the wrong formula.
- reading a measuring device incorrectly (thermometer, balance, etc.)
- not cleaning the equipment.

What are the types and causes of human error?
There are 3 types of active human error: Slips and lapses – made inadvertently by experienced operators during routine tasks; Mistakes – decisions subsequently found to be wrong, though the maker believed them to be correct at the time; and. Violations – deliberate deviations from rules for safe operation of equipment.

What are the causes of human error?
Factors present in our working environment can cause human error. These “stressors” can range from poor lighting, complex documentation, inconsistent processes, illogical material flows through to company culture, inadequate communication and inaccurate and insensitive performance measures.

What kind of human errors can occur during experiments?
Scientists recognize that experimental findings may be imprecise due to variables difficult to control, such as changes in room temperature, slight miscalibrations in lab instruments, or a flawed research design. However, scientists and college professors have little tolerance for human errors occurring due to carelessness or sloppy technique.
